In this episode of the Capstone Conversation, host Jared discusses pet welfare and community impact with Dr. Walani Sung, a board-certified veterinary behaviorist. Dr. Sung, who oversees animal admissions and well-being at Joybound People and Pets, talks about the organization's efforts to aid the pet community in the greater East Bay area. They delve into topics such as pet adoption trends during and post-COVID, challenges with strays, and the importance of socializing pets. Dr. Sung highlights Joybound's various programs, including fostering psychiatric service dogs, vocational training for aspiring groomers, and community outreach like free vaccine clinics. The conversation underscores Joybound's commitment to strengthening the human-animal bond and addressing broader societal issues such as housing and mental health support.
